Investment Options on Mobile trading platform

Mobile trading platforms offer a range of investment options that cater to different investor preferences. I will cover key areas including stocks, options, cryptocurrencies, and mutual funds. Understanding these options helps in making informed decisions.

1. Stocks and ETFs Trading
Investing in stocks and exchange-traded funds (ETFs) is straightforward on mobile platforms. You can buy and sell shares of companies quickly. Many apps, like Fidelity and Charles Schwab, provide useful features like real-time data and market analysis. ETFs allow diversification because they hold multiple stocks. For example, an ETF could focus on technology companies, giving exposure to giants like Apple and Microsoft. Additionally, many trading apps offer commission-free trades, making it easier to invest without worrying about fees. This accessibility improves my investment flexibility.

2. Options and Futures
Options and futures trading add complexity to mobile investing. Options allow me to buy or sell stocks at a specific price before a deadline. This strategy can enhance potential profits but involves higher risks. Many apps offer educational resources to help understand options trading. Futures contracts work similarly but involve commodities or indexes. I can agree to buy or sell an asset at a future date, which is beneficial in volatile markets. Some platforms provide tools for risk management, making it easier to navigate these investments.

3. Cryptocurrency Integration
Cryptocurrency investing has become popular, and many mobile platforms now support trading. I can invest in currencies like Bitcoin and Ethereum directly from my app. These platforms often have simplified interfaces that help me buy, sell, or hold crypto easily. Market volatility is a key factor in crypto trading. Apps often provide real-time market data, allowing me to make timely decisions. Some platforms offer educational content about cryptocurrencies, which is useful for understanding this rapidly changing market.

4. Fractional Share and Mutual Fund Investments
Fractional shares allow me to invest in a piece of expensive stocks, making investing more accessible. For instance, I can buy a fraction of a share of a company like Amazon instead of needing to purchase a whole share. Many mobile trading apps support this feature. Mutual funds are also an option. They pool money from multiple investors to buy a diversified portfolio of stocks or bonds. Some platforms have automatic investment options, which can help me grow my portfolio over time. This can simplify my investment strategy and align with my financial goals.
